Nucleotidylation of unsaturated carbasugar in validamycin biosynthesis

Abstract: Validamycin A is a member of microbial-derived C7N-aminocyclitol family of natural products that is widely used as crop protectant and the precursor of the antidiabetic drug voglibose. Its biosynthetic gene clusters have been identified in several Streptomyces hygroscopicus strains, and a number of genes within the clusters have been functionally analyzed. “…Therefore, we prepared all five possible NDP-valienols and evaluated the substrate preference of VldE – whether or not it can process other NDP-valienols. GDP-, ADP-, and CDP-valienols were prepared from valienol 1-phosphate and their corresponding nucleotidyl triphosphates (GTP, ATP, or CTP), using VldB (Yang et al, 2011), whereas UDP- and dTDP-valienol were prepared from valienol 1-phosphate and UTP and dTTP, respectively, using RmlA-L89T, an engineered broad spectrum nucleotidyltransferase (Moretti et al, 2011), kindly provided by Prof. Jon Thorson at the University of Kentucky (Figures S2A and S2B). Although RmlA-L89T has been known to have relaxed substrate specificity towards various sugar phosphates (Moretti et al, 2011), the present study showed that RmlA-L89T is also able to process an unsaturated carbasugar phosphate.…”
